2026-07-072026-07-07http://salesiana.dossiersoluciones.com/handle/123456789/226276Let M be a closed, connected, orientable 3-manifold. The purpose of this paper is to study the Seiberg-Witten Floer homology of M given that S^1 X M admits a symplectic form. In particular, we prove that M fibers over the circle if M has first Betti number 1 and S^1 X M admits a symplectic form with non-torsion canonical class.This is the version published by Geometry & Topology on 1 January 2009Symplectic GeometryGeometric TopologySeiberg-Witten Floer homology and symplectic forms on S^1 X M^3text
